Does Google Cloud support IPv6?

Google Cloud supports IPv6 clients with global external HTTP(S) load balancers, SSL Proxy Load Balancing, and TCP Proxy Load Balancing. The load balancer accepts IPv6 connections from your users, and then proxies those connections to your backends.

Is IPv6 being used currently?

As of March 2022, according to Google, the IPv6 adoption rate globally is around 34%, but in the U.S. it’s at about 46%. Carrier networks and ISPs have been the first group to start deploying IPv6 on their networks, with mobile networks leading the charge.

Does Google Fiber support IPv6?

IPv6 is a newer protocol being introduced to the Internet over an extended period. Google Fiber supports IPv6, but you do not have to use it. If you do not use it now, you can change your mind later.

Should I enable both IPv4 and IPv6 on my router?

When possible, it is better to keep both IPv4 and IPv6 addresses enabled. For example, using only IPv6 can cause some accessibility issues, as only about one third of the internet supports IPv6 addresses. Likewise, disabling IPv6 can cause certain problems, especially if your router is already using an IPv6 address.

How do I ping Google IPv6 address?

To test Internet connectivity with IPv6 host name resolution:

  1. Type ping ipv6.google.com and press Enter.
  2. Observe the results. If you see replies indicating success, you have Internet connectivity and IPv6 host name resolution.
  3. Close the command prompt to complete this activity.

Does 5G require IPv6?

Q: Will IPv6 have a place in 5G or is IPv4 sufficient? BL: IPv6 will have a big place in 5G, primarily because of the Internet of Things (IoT), which will add billions of new devices to this mobile network as it’s roll out. IPv4 cannot cope with the number of unique IP addresses that will be required, but IPv6 can.

Is Google Fiber static or dynamic IP?

When you sign up for Google Fiber, you can choose to have no (zero) static IP addresses (that is, dynamic IPs for all your devices), one static IP, or multiple static IPs. When you sign up for static IPs, we will assign addresses to you when your service is installed and activated.
